Greek Mythology courses generally explore the major gods and goddesses of Mount Olympus, creation myths, and epic tales like the Trojan War and the journeys of Odysseus and Heracles. Students also study the cultural significance of these myths in ancient Greek society, how they influenced literature and art, and their lasting impact on Western civilization. Understanding these foundational stories helps students engage with references to mythology across history, literature, and humanities courses.
Many students struggle with keeping track of the large cast of characters, their relationships, and the different versions of myths that exist across ancient sources. Others find it difficult to analyze the deeper themes and cultural meanings behind the stories, moving beyond simple plot summary. Additionally, connecting mythological concepts to broader coursework in literature, history, or philosophy can feel overwhelming without guidance on how these narratives shaped Western thought.

Effective mythology essays require moving beyond plot summary to explore themes, symbolism, and cultural context—analyzing why a myth mattered to ancient Greeks and what it reveals about their values. Tutors can help you develop a clear thesis, find textual evidence to support your arguments, and structure your analysis logically. They'll also guide you on comparing different versions of myths and connecting them to broader historical or literary contexts, which often strengthens academic writing.
Effective exam preparation involves organizing information strategically—creating timelines of major events, character relationship charts, and thematic summaries rather than trying to memorize every detail. Practice quizzes help you identify which areas need more focus, and tutors can teach you test-taking strategies like identifying key terms in essay prompts and managing your time across multiple questions. Regular review sessions using spaced repetition strengthen long-term retention of complex mythological narratives and their interpretations.
